Back when he was unveiling the former Aladdin as the new Planet
Hollywood casino, owner Robert Earl made some pretty lofty claims
about what his resort would mean for Vegas. That was then. Earlier
this year, Earl turned over control of the property to Harrah’s
Entertainment, unable to keep his head above water amid these
unprecedented, perilous economic times. Earl, naturally, has no
regrets as he explains in this episode what his role will be going
forward and why the old one-property entrepreneur model of Strip
ownership is, for the most part, dead. Other topics on the agenda:
CityCenter, Prive, the Palms and his memorabilia stash.
David McKee of the Las Vegas Advisor fills in for Vegas, bantering
about Macau perils, CityCenter data, Goss branding, surprising
Strip charges and much more.
